BELCHERTOWN, Mass. (WWLP) - The snow and cold temperatures in March aren't only causing problems on the road; they're causing problems at home.
When temperatures drop outside, people have to turn up the heat inside and with home heating oil prices around 3.70 a gallon; this new round of snow is taking a toll.
Gas prices continue to wreak havoc to budgets. The good news, gas prices are down, something we haven't seen since last year.
However, not down by much. In the Greater Springfield area gas is around 3.69 only down 3 cents from last week. This has some scrimping and literally putting in the bare minimum.
“Yeah, I've got a big family, a family of five, I've got four kids so yeah I cut back on everything,” said Dan Lauren of Ware.
Gas prices aren’t expected to take a big dip anytime soon. People 22News spoke with say they hope spring hurries up so they can cut back at least on the home heating oil.
